Steve...your on the right track.....If I may make one slight suggestion.....You seem to be covering your bar hand...show more bar by moving your hand back a bit..try to hold the bar under your first finger supported by your thumb..the rest of your hand can then lie comfortably behind the bar giving you more controll...just a thought...IMHO..if you can get with David..I'm sure he could help you...all in all you'd doing great..keep it up..
